The Fundraising Strategy Playbook: An Entrepreneur’s Guide To Pitching, Raising Venture Capital, and Financing a Startup

English | 2021 | ASIN: B08YSLCR41 | 122 Pages | Epub | 154 KB

Why do promising companies run out of money? How do you raise capital to effectively achieve your milestones and bring your vision to life? How do you tailor your fundraising plan to your exit strategy and bring on investors aligned with your goals?

Imagine selling your company for $50 million, and walking away with little money in the bank to show for it. This is a surprisingly common scenario that can be prevented with good fundraising advice.

Packed with insights from legendary venture capitalists such as Brad Feld (The Foundry Group), to innovation enthusiasts like Jason Feifer (Editor in Chief of Entrepreneur Magazine), this book provides a refreshing perspective on how startup founders should approach raising capital for their companies.

Whether you’re a first-time startup founder looking to get up to speed on everything you need to get started with a fundraise or an experienced founder interested in learning about how to strategically finance your company for its long term success, this book is just the resource for you.

In this book, you’ll learn how to

Deliver a compelling pitch
Understand startup investment terms
Evaluate founder/funder fit
Build your funding stack according to your exit strategy
Access non-dilutive sources of capital
Effectively raise a round of financing

Filled with answers to the questions you wish you could ask the most acclaimed entrepreneurs and investors, this is the entrepreneur’s playbook on how to intelligently raise capital for the long term success of their startup. Collectively ingrained in this book are insights from Kleiner Perkins, Floodgate Capital, Accel, Techstars, 500 Startups, Cowboy Ventures, StartEngine, and more.

This book covers

Part 1) Fundraising Fundamentals (sources of capital, venture capital fundraising process, and more)
Part 2) Elements + Design Principles of a Pitch Deck
Part 3) The Art of Persuasive Pitching
Part 4) Fundraising Strategy (how to plan a raise, types of investments, designing your funding stack, evaluating founder/funder fit, and more)
Part 5) Fundraising Strategy for Female Founders
Part 6) Fundraising Strategy for International Companies
